FOURTEEN chiringuitos in Torre del Mar and Benajarafe were presented with Q for Tourism Quality certificates and plaques on Monday at the first joint ceremony of its kind in Spain. The event was attended by deputy mayor for Torre del Mar and tourism and beaches councillor Jesus Perez Atencia, general director of the Spanish Tourism Quality Institute Fernando Fraile and general director of certifier OCA CERT

Perez Atencia explained: “the Ministry of Tourism’s Tourism Quality Institute has certified us under regulation 167.000/2006 and we have obtained the Q for Tourism Quality for 14 chiringuitos. We’re the first place to receive this distinction for 14 businesses simultaneously.”

Fraile stressed “Torre del Mar has made a great effort which will reap rewards in the future as a quality certification ensures everyone values the businesses concerned. The keys to the future are sustainability, accessibility, new technologies, training and imagination and all of that comes under the umbrella of the Q for Quality.”

By John Smith A HUGE window pane weighing about 200 kilos fell out of the Tourism Development Centre in Motril which cost €14 million of European Union money to build according to a report issued by the town hall. The deputy mayor Francisco Sánchez-Cantalejo and councillor Gloria Chica

viewed the site on Friday November 25 and were horrified at what had happened and questioned whether this was caused by poor construction. In the meantime, officers from the Motril Fire Brigade made a preliminary review of the building checking for other potential defects but have concluded that it is safe although the area where the

problem arose has been cordoned off and they await the arrival of experts from the construction company to give an explanation of the cause of the problem. It has been decided that the cinema and children’s areas are safe and that visitors may continue to enter the building and use its facilities provided that they keep away from the cordoned off area.
